Commit Graph

2076 Commits

Author SHA1 Message Date
7811d3c444 flake.lock: Update
Flake lock file updates:

• Updated input 'zentralwerk':
    '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=refs%2fheads%2fmaster&rev=c52991536725810f596cd25616a359a60b3d9aa7' (2022-11-27)
  → '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=refs%2fheads%2fmaster&rev=15e1e9fb1c55ec5fb62f4c7e61bf63aee5c35eeb' (2022-11-29)
2022-11-30 00:22:34 +01:00
828a374f38 flake.lock: Update
Flake lock file updates:

• Updated input 'fenix':
    'github:nix-community/fenix/864fe18d688b0c8c0730bb179b6686eac951f613' (2022-11-28)
  → 'github:nix-community/fenix/723bf93513f1331961c5251817214e64d306b24a' (2022-11-29)
• Updated input 'nixos':
    'github:nixos/nixpkgs/899e7caf59d1954882a8e2dff45ccc0387c186f6' (2022-11-26)
  → 'github:nixos/nixpkgs/ce5fe99df1f15a09a91a86be9738d68fadfbad82' (2022-11-27)
• Updated input 'nixos-hardware':
    'github:nixos/nixos-hardware/0099253ad0b5283f06ffe31cf010af3f9ad7837d' (2022-11-22)
  → 'github:nixos/nixos-hardware/7883883d135ce5b7eae5dce4bfa12262b85c1c46' (2022-11-28)
• Updated input 'nixos-unstable':
    'github:nixos/nixpkgs/5dc7114b7b256d217fe7752f1614be2514e61bb8' (2022-11-25)
  → 'github:nixos/nixpkgs/a115bb9bd56831941be3776c8a94005867f316a7' (2022-11-27)
• Updated input 'openwrt-imagebuilder':
    'github:astro/nix-openwrt-imagebuilder/142354dc1d32d307eaaf2c77ff56cb12c9ca3169' (2022-11-27)
  → 'github:astro/nix-openwrt-imagebuilder/e3b0754ab36871291da773355932c58ac81b3952' (2022-11-28)
• Updated input 'rust-overlay':
    'github:oxalica/rust-overlay/b9da8e68a08707115be750c0cf7ade33f49d8ec4' (2022-11-28)
  → 'github:oxalica/rust-overlay/4e093ce661a63aca4bcbace33695225eae4ef4e4' (2022-11-29)
2022-11-29 10:01:14 +01:00
7d203cb0d2 .sops.yaml: add hosts/prometheus 2022-11-29 02:11:39 +01:00
af51086c18 caveman: bump microvm.mem from 8G to 16G 2022-11-29 02:10:49 +01:00
69a66f3eba flake.lock: Update
Flake lock file updates:

• Updated input 'caveman':
    'git+https://gitea.c3d2.de/astro/caveman.git?ref=main&rev=691af99c36ad47bdf143df027766de2b2f349175' (2022-11-25)
  → 'git+https://gitea.c3d2.de/astro/caveman.git?ref=main&rev=404767d88b4a383b594b0a259ca6187861bf6b89' (2022-11-29)
2022-11-29 02:10:43 +01:00
c21bae9dd6 flake.lock: Update
Flake lock file updates:

• Updated input 'fenix':
    'github:nix-community/fenix/0d4b86633d6c5438a7b97d485f02e7e18101a541' (2022-11-25)
  → 'github:nix-community/fenix/864fe18d688b0c8c0730bb179b6686eac951f613' (2022-11-28)
• Updated input 'fenix/rust-analyzer-src':
    'github:rust-lang/rust-analyzer/1e6a49a801708a8bcbe429ce03f614a7951bdb11' (2022-11-24)
  → 'github:rust-lang/rust-analyzer/6d61be8e65ac0fd45eaf178e1f7a1ec6b582de1f' (2022-11-27)
• Updated input 'nixos':
    'github:nixos/nixpkgs/8690906c4d80db5d85f52313a8487bf2e7b8d4c5' (2022-11-25)
  → 'github:nixos/nixpkgs/899e7caf59d1954882a8e2dff45ccc0387c186f6' (2022-11-26)
• Updated input 'nixos-unstable':
    'github:nixos/nixpkgs/27ccd29078f974ddbdd7edc8e38c8c8ae003c877' (2022-11-24)
  → 'github:nixos/nixpkgs/5dc7114b7b256d217fe7752f1614be2514e61bb8' (2022-11-25)
• Updated input 'openwrt':
    'git+https://git.openwrt.org/openwrt/openwrt.git?ref=openwrt-21.02&rev=829cc60a281b9da1ede262d32f1359b4d997555f' (2022-11-24)
  → 'git+https://git.openwrt.org/openwrt/openwrt.git?ref=openwrt-21.02&rev=b33090a0faf73d5d03e96c132c413776d6ed8b87' (2022-11-27)
• Updated input 'openwrt-imagebuilder':
    'github:astro/nix-openwrt-imagebuilder/a34bbf93ead52375a103ba5ad4a147062cea8a89' (2022-11-25)
  → 'github:astro/nix-openwrt-imagebuilder/142354dc1d32d307eaaf2c77ff56cb12c9ca3169' (2022-11-27)
• Updated input 'rust-overlay':
    'github:oxalica/rust-overlay/87fee4b5b0ed4bc7f6db2e878a8c93db8d631e01' (2022-11-25)
  → 'github:oxalica/rust-overlay/b9da8e68a08707115be750c0cf7ade33f49d8ec4' (2022-11-28)
• Updated input 'sops-nix':
    'github:Mic92/sops-nix/f72e050c3ef148b1131a0d2df55385c045e4166b' (2022-11-20)
  → 'github:Mic92/sops-nix/a01f386f34a854fe4f8754e62a6837748bc84a8a' (2022-11-27)
2022-11-28 10:01:13 +01:00
d99d4129f3 modules/cluster/deployment: add operator to needForSpeed nomad affinity 2022-11-28 01:16:54 +01:00
07bfd31ee7 modules/cluster/deployment: disable nix.gc.automatic 2022-11-28 01:16:36 +01:00
b3caf1a39b Merge leon's branch 2022-11-28 00:49:52 +01:00
18d0694b10 modules/cluster/default: add additional gcroots symlink 2022-11-28 00:49:14 +01:00
71a611467d stream: fix pub network 2022-11-27 17:23:47 +01:00
c469c46ffe prometheus: add scrape 2022-11-27 02:29:59 +01:00
e85c3d8c51 prometheus: redeploy 2022-11-27 01:38:44 +01:00
da110aa138 prometheus: redeploy 2022-11-27 01:36:56 +01:00
27a6cdfed8 flake.lock: Update input zentralwerk
Flake lock file updates:

• Updated input 'zentralwerk':
    '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=refs%2fheads%2fmaster&rev=5113cf888d44e8e333e3f4ae0e39e898b0151e1e' (2022-11-24)
  → '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=refs%2fheads%2fmaster&rev=c52991536725810f596cd25616a359a60b3d9aa7' (2022-11-27)
2022-11-27 01:12:00 +01:00
4f785ca1c9 update 2022-11-26 21:28:30 +00:00
b53c53a6f7 update 2022-11-26 17:37:34 +00:00
97b7d2d71f update 2022-11-26 17:34:22 +00:00
b70d9bcb78 update 2022-11-26 17:30:36 +00:00
e141ce6ee0 update 2022-11-26 14:59:39 +00:00
6bc6834498 update 2022-11-26 14:58:50 +00:00
dadf8c72c7 update 2022-11-26 14:58:23 +00:00
966bb7389f update 2022-11-26 14:56:10 +00:00
8c1b350f1a update 2022-11-26 14:53:02 +00:00
c61bb308a3 Merge leon's branch 2022-11-26 03:06:58 +01:00
588bebc3cf modules/cluster/deployment-options: fix 2022-11-26 02:55:12 +01:00
9ad4bd0649 modules/cluster/deployment-options: fix networks 2022-11-26 02:53:32 +01:00
035617c112 sdrweb: enable needForSpeed to prefer server10's cpu 2022-11-26 02:52:14 +01:00
2b2982961c update 2022-11-26 01:51:49 +00:00
c67ba25488 update 2022-11-26 01:48:17 +00:00
a33b2abe29 update 2022-11-26 01:47:34 +00:00
e91e69b14a modules/cluster/deployment-options: add hacks to allow build on hydra 2022-11-26 02:41:51 +01:00
7bc3b49cc3 modules/cluster/deployment: let microvms specify their nets by providing just a default 2022-11-26 01:41:28 +01:00
65a91dc324 stream: skyflakify 2022-11-26 01:39:35 +01:00
e6ab80fc5e Merge https://gitea.c3d2.de/c3d2/nix-config 2022-11-26 00:33:20 +00:00
d95e924778 modules/cluster/default: remove debug output 2022-11-26 00:35:07 +01:00
de9ce610e9 modules/cluster/deployment: add option deployment.needForSpeed 2022-11-26 00:34:41 +01:00
b9e42515c7 flake.nix: s/fenix.overlay/fenix.overlays.default/ 2022-11-26 00:30:36 +01:00
930c3a67e0 update 2022-11-25 23:27:45 +00:00
699a043d24 flake.nix: remove nixpkgs-unstable from nixosConfigurations for the nixos-22.11 upgrade 2022-11-26 00:16:05 +01:00
0669b29a23 Merge https://gitea.c3d2.de/c3d2/nix-config 2022-11-25 22:50:56 +00:00
572af7e31d leoncloud: skyflakify 2022-11-25 23:42:04 +01:00
ebf4e41b73 modules/cluster: start supporting multiple storages 2022-11-25 23:07:54 +01:00
27d2252d11 flake.lock: Update
Flake lock file updates:

• Updated input 'affection-src':
    'git+https://gitea.nek0.eu/nek0/affection?ref=master&rev=b56ed86e45b2a8cdf811f2659644192a69ab5818' (2022-09-14)
  → 'git+https://gitea.nek0.eu/nek0/affection?ref=refs%2fheads%2fmaster&rev=b56ed86e45b2a8cdf811f2659644192a69ab5818' (2022-09-14)
• Updated input 'caveman':
    'git+https://gitea.c3d2.de/astro/caveman.git?ref=main&rev=b4ee13f46de3287a868ddba9ba9b970140ab99c9' (2022-11-20)
  → 'git+https://gitea.c3d2.de/astro/caveman.git?ref=main&rev=691af99c36ad47bdf143df027766de2b2f349175' (2022-11-25)
• Updated input 'fenix':
    'github:nix-community/fenix/72b820427fbd59a55368cda4de159134764e3ff6' (2022-11-23)
  → 'github:nix-community/fenix/0d4b86633d6c5438a7b97d485f02e7e18101a541' (2022-11-25)
• Updated input 'fenix/rust-analyzer-src':
    'github:rust-lang/rust-analyzer/26562973b3482a635416b2b663a13016d4d90e20' (2022-11-20)
  → 'github:rust-lang/rust-analyzer/1e6a49a801708a8bcbe429ce03f614a7951bdb11' (2022-11-24)
• Updated input 'heliwatch':
    'git+https://gitea.c3d2.de/astro/heliwatch.git?ref=master&rev=f7cf04a7ad47e388121f0771651fec0df91407f3' (2022-07-15)
  → 'git+https://gitea.c3d2.de/astro/heliwatch.git?ref=refs%2fheads%2fmaster&rev=f7cf04a7ad47e388121f0771651fec0df91407f3' (2022-07-15)
• Updated input 'microvm':
    'github:astro/microvm.nix/682b1e76e7fefdf350f3dc9e84002a8488e2b86d' (2022-11-21)
  → 'github:astro/microvm.nix/c21a70fe1ac05ccdfceff6506625e9d44cd91da5' (2022-11-24)
• Updated input 'nixos':
    'github:nixos/nixpkgs/c9538a9b7074925ac117835c775fb81d0e7f98fa' (2022-11-22)
  → 'github:nixos/nixpkgs/8690906c4d80db5d85f52313a8487bf2e7b8d4c5' (2022-11-25)
• Updated input 'nixos-unstable':
    'github:nixos/nixpkgs/2788904d26dda6cfa1921c5abb7a2466ffe3cb8c' (2022-11-22)
  → 'github:nixos/nixpkgs/27ccd29078f974ddbdd7edc8e38c8c8ae003c877' (2022-11-24)
• Updated input 'openwrt':
    'git+https://git.openwrt.org/openwrt/openwrt.git?ref=openwrt-21.02&rev=079ce0413a1e3c19dd00be1b90de737c2bc09223' (2022-11-13)
  → 'git+https://git.openwrt.org/openwrt/openwrt.git?ref=openwrt-21.02&rev=829cc60a281b9da1ede262d32f1359b4d997555f' (2022-11-24)
• Updated input 'openwrt-imagebuilder':
    'github:astro/nix-openwrt-imagebuilder/56c7ad52bb513497b458a71f34378103497847d2' (2022-11-22)
  → 'github:astro/nix-openwrt-imagebuilder/a34bbf93ead52375a103ba5ad4a147062cea8a89' (2022-11-25)
• Updated input 'rust-overlay':
    'github:oxalica/rust-overlay/c90c223c4aef334356029b89c72bb65e26f7efe6' (2022-11-23)
  → 'github:oxalica/rust-overlay/87fee4b5b0ed4bc7f6db2e878a8c93db8d631e01' (2022-11-25)
• Updated input 'scrapers':
    'git+https://gitea.c3d2.de/astro/scrapers.git?ref=master&rev=3700761dd06f271ef26261ed2a90dce8c22b6dca' (2022-10-10)
  → 'git+https://gitea.c3d2.de/astro/scrapers.git?ref=refs%2fheads%2fmaster&rev=3700761dd06f271ef26261ed2a90dce8c22b6dca' (2022-10-10)
• Updated input 'secrets':
    'git+ssh://gitea@gitea.c3d2.de/c3d2-admins/secrets.git?ref=master&rev=5ca106f648bef15d9954d956bda336eea28e8d75' (2022-08-07)
  → 'git+ssh://gitea@gitea.c3d2.de/c3d2-admins/secrets.git?ref=refs%2fheads%2fmaster&rev=5ca106f648bef15d9954d956bda336eea28e8d75' (2022-08-07)
• Updated input 'skyflake':
    'github:astro/skyflake/365bfb5aa5b42a48b18c4fc0d9cab30bcd62c74a' (2022-11-21)
  → 'github:astro/skyflake/162a95bbe72c91f2a43ea40773761464e2c659cc' (2022-11-25)
• Updated input 'ticker':
    'git+https://gitea.c3d2.de/astro/ticker.git?ref=master&rev=22ecb2b375bebffdfb1af3435a4c4486e6dd923b' (2022-10-23)
  → 'git+https://gitea.c3d2.de/astro/ticker.git?ref=refs%2fheads%2fmaster&rev=22ecb2b375bebffdfb1af3435a4c4486e6dd923b' (2022-10-23)
• Updated input 'tracer':
    'git+https://gitea.c3d2.de/astro/tracer?ref=master&rev=6d8d2cb1268d26add05baa3f21c325cfe051add3' (2022-09-15)
  → 'git+https://gitea.c3d2.de/astro/tracer?ref=refs%2fheads%2fmaster&rev=6d8d2cb1268d26add05baa3f21c325cfe051add3' (2022-09-15)
• Updated input 'zentralwerk':
    '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=master&rev=9af9b5fef3208dcea17fc1e53936772238d34ae4' (2022-11-21)
  → 'git+https://gitea.c3d2.de/zentralwerk/network.git?ref=refs%2fheads%2fmaster&rev=5113cf888d44e8e333e3f4ae0e39e898b0151e1e' (2022-11-24)
2022-11-25 23:07:54 +01:00
9c9c52b659 Merge pull request 'leon' (#90) from leon/nix-config:leon into master
Reviewed-on: #90
2022-11-25 23:07:19 +01:00
3c0c101dd7 update 2022-11-25 18:33:58 +00:00
deb314f8e4 update 2022-11-25 18:05:46 +00:00
7a19ac58e3 modules/cluster/default: add glusterfs big 2022-11-24 21:03:54 +01:00
79dcef419e modules/cluster/default: add server8 2022-11-24 19:37:42 +01:00
8c9afdf9b8 server8: init 2022-11-24 18:48:34 +01:00